On this
trip you have an opportunity to explore one of the most beautiful parts in Sapa
area, which is under protection of HoangLienNational
Park. The night you spend in campsite nearby a
river will bememorialmomentsalong the trek.Youwillalsobeabletomeetseveraldifferentminorities, which
cannot be found in other areas of Sapa, such as Giay in Muong Hoa valley, Tay and Xa Pho in
Ban Ho
valley. Both valleys are beautiful with mountainous surrounding and rice paddy
terraces.
Itinerary:
Day 1: Sapa - Cat Cat - Y Linh Ho -
Tavan (-, L, D)
Met up at
your hotel in Sapa by local guide and driver and start your trek through the
market and
leave the
busy town behind. After a couple of minutes, you follow a road going downhill
to Cat Cat village. You will stop by a waterfall and a hydroelectric station
for a while before you trekon a dirt trailthroughricepaddyterraces.Youalsowillenjoyspectacularscenerywhilewalkingalonga narrow river. You eventually arrive in Y Linh Ho village of Black Hmong
minority, where you can take a rest while you are served lunch nearby the
river.
After
lunch, youheadMuong Hoa valley.You will passthroughLaoChaivillageofBlack
Hmong minority and then Tavan village of Giay
minority by following a very popular trekking route.You will spend the night in local house of
Giay minority. You will be able to take a walk to enjoy the valley view as well
as swim in the river nearby.
Approx: 5
hours walking/ 1-hour lunch.
Day 2: Tavan - Seomity (B, L, D)
After
having breakfast, you start today?s trek, which is mostly uphill until
lunchtime. Whenever you stop for a rest, you will be able to enjoy valley view.
Before noon, you stop again at a nice spot for lunch. The trek will be softer
in the afternoon. But the scenery becomes even more beautiful. You pass by Seomity
village of Black Hmong minority before you arrive in
a campsite,whichlocatesnearbya river outside the
village. While porters put up tents and cook dinner, you can take a walk to
stretch the legs.
Approx: 4
hours walking/ 1 hour lunch
Day 3: Seomity - Den Thang - Ta
Trung Ho (B, L, D)
The trek
today takes you through beautiful rice paddies and over old suspension bridges.
You will trek on small trail sneaking through rainforest. You arrive in Den
Thang village of Black Hmong by noon. Here you stop for
lunch either nearby a river or in a local school according to the weather. After
lunch, the trek will becomes tough on tinny footpath going up and down, which
requires a lot of concentration. You will reach to TaTrung Ho village of Red Dao
minority where you spend the night in local house. Both the valley and the
village have just received foreign visitors. The night will be even more
interesting when you are in the wonderful hospitable atmosphere of the Red Dao.
Approx: 4
hours walking, 1-hour lunch
Day 4: Ta Trung Ho - Nam Toong - Ban
Ho - Sapa (B, L, -)
You are
now at the fringe of the rain forest by the Hoang Lien Son mountain range.
Fansipan, the highest peak in Indochina with
its 3143 m, is located in this mountain range. You will start the trek today by
ascending to Nam Toong village
of Red Dao minority. Here
y our lunch will be prepared in a local school. In the afternoon, before
descending to Ban Ho, you can make a stop by a waterfall to refresh. Then our
car takes you on the journey back to Sapa.
